This tool is built to interface with Canvas, a Learning Management System built by Instructure. It provides the framework for a development team to build and deploy mass-maintenance tools. It is not built by Instructure. It was built by Brigham Young University - Idaho, and is maintained by them.

Setup - Production

To set up your own instance of Katana, follow these steps:

  1. Install Git and use it to clone the repository

  2. Install NodeJS if is not installed

  3. In the terminal, run: npm install

  4. (TEMP: Set up CANVAS_API_TOKEN environment variable | Will become canvas developer key)

  5. Deploy Firebase using the steps described in this document

  6. Build production files with ng build --prod

  1. In the terminal, run: npm start to start server.js (which will start Katana on port 8000)

  2. Follow any additional setup processes you need

Development

For development, use this command to build the angular front-end and launch the server immediately after:

npm run fullbuild

It can then be accessed via localhost:8000 (or whichever port you specify in server/settings.json).

You can also deploy it for others to use by using your IP Address and your port number. So if you were running on port 8000 and your IP Address was 10.1.182.255 then you could deploy it on your network with the url 10.1.182.255:8000, though hosting it on a server with a url for your users to access would of course be better.
